Umbartha

Umbartha ( IPA:Umbaraṭhā) is a 1982 Marathi film produced by D. V. Rao and directed and coproduced by Dr. Jabbar Patel. The film is a story of a woman's dream to step outside her four walled home and bring change in the society. Smita Patil played the lead protagonist in the film for which she won Marathi Rajya Chitrapat Puraskar for Best Actress. The film was adjudged as the Best Feature Film in Marathi at the 29th National Film Awards for "a sincere cinematic statement on the theme of a woman seeking to establish her identity by pursuing a career, even at the risk of alienation from her family".

The film is based on a Marathi novel "Beghar" (translation: Homeless) by Shanta Nisal and was also simultaneously made in Hindi as Subah with the same cast.
